Summary

Old and new Butetown; Auntie Eva's club in James St; Her adopted family; Her real parent's background; Views on discrimination and slavery; Living conditions, discrimination in the Docks; African and W. Indian cooking; The riots the 'Bengal Tiger' her uncle Henry Thomas; The colour ban on 'the York' pub; Attitudes of whites, when first worked in theatre; Show business career - Sam Manning, Magabi and Delgado; Lists of famous people from area - Emlyn Nixon, Erskine and the ' African Princess' (Lisa); View on Liza's death; Sunday's arrival in Cardiff in 1943; Cultural identity; Eva's experience of Africa; Stories of slavery; Affection from her adopted mother; Background on real father. Mystery surrounding 'The Bengal Tigers' death and his status within Butetown Community; Customs and supernatural activities of ancient tribes.
